Stir Coffee Brixton is a welcoming neighbourhood restaurant serving fresh, modern brunch and lunch dishes. Known for its specialty coffee and relaxed atmosphere, it's a popular local spot. Ideal for a casual catch-up or a productive morning with excellent coffee.

While I can’t deny that the coffee and food here is fantastic, while I was waiting for my coffee a guy with his tumi luggage walked in, shortly followed by a girl with her “ludicrously capacious”fendi bag, which ought to tell you everything you need to know about the clientele, middle/upper-middle class urbanites who work on their 2.4K 16 inch MacBook Pro’s. (which was also present) All of this would be tolerable as well if the cafe was indeed cozy but the decor is barren, there is no cozy chair, couch or chaise lounge in sight and clickety clack of coffee making is an assault on all senses. It’s the poster child for gentrification. Neither upmarket enough that you feel it’s a place to be seen, nor homely enough that you want to loiter around, it’s tasteless, soulless and too loud. It’s for the WeWork crowd and their ilk to work on their online businesses sitting on uncomfortable picnic tables and benches. It remains preferable to pret but only by a slim margin, which is horrifying to think about an independent establishment. If only they would change the furniture, lighting, decor and music, it would be more welcoming, and perhaps attract a more diverse crowd.

We’ve become regulars here, and honestly, it’s one of the best cafés I’ve found in over thirty years in London. The coffee is consistently outstanding, the atmosphere is awesome and welcoming, and the staff are genuinely kind, nothing ever feels forced. It’s the kind of place where everyone, feels at home. Their sandwiches, cakes, and custard donuts are amazing too. The music is great, and even when it gets lively with families and kids over the weekend, it keeps that same lovely, welcoming energy! It truly has that lovely Italian vibe, where they know your name and your coffee order!
